How do I know if I need to keep my child home?

While we acknowledge that allergies and the common cold still exist, our primary goal remains to keep our students healthy and on campus. In partnership, we ask our parents to adhere to the following guidelines when assessing whether or not their child should attend school.

If your child has ONE of the following symptoms, they should not attend school or extracurricular activities:

  • Fever (100.0° or higher without fever-reducing medications)
  • Persistent Cough
  • Nausea/Vomiting or Diarrhea
  • Unusual Fatigue/Persistent Tiredness

If your child has TWO or more of the following symptoms, they should not attend school or extracurricular activities:

  • Persistent Chills
  • Muscle Pain/Body Aches
  • Sore Throat/Hoarseness
  • New Loss of Taste or Smell
  • Headache
  • Uncharacteristic Allergy-like Symptoms

What if my child exhibits symptoms while at school?

The appropriate division nurse will notify you, asking that you pick up your child and consult with your family physician.

Is Fellowship’s campus still open to visitors?

To protect the health of our students, faculty, and staff, parents should also abide by the symptom protocols listed above. If a parent has symptoms, tested positive within the last 10 days, or there is an active positive case in the household, the parent should not be on campus. Any vaccinated individual without symptoms may continue to come on campus when there is a positive case in the household.

What is the protocol if someone in the household is being tested for COVID-19?

If your child has a pending COVID-19 test, they may NOT come to school.

If a parent has a pending COVID-19 test, the child with no symptoms may come to school.

If a sibling has a pending COVID-19 test, your child with no symptoms that is not being tested may come to school.

What is Fellowship’s international travel policy?

For international travel, FCS follows the U.S. Department of State entry requirements and restrictions for travelers arriving back in the US. Please visit travel.state.gov for more information.
